Tak Weaver
Tak Weaver was a member of the Weaver Family and a paladin in service of Sirnai "Spirit of Safe Journies, the River Huntry". He was a goodly man who was always trying to help others.
During Tak's travels, he managed to find the Axe of the Unnamed, a relic that once belonged to Sirnai herself during the Age of Spirits. Using the magic of the axe, he could see souls who did not travel on to the Eternal Domain. It became his duty to resolve their deaths and help them move on.

Personal history
In the year 436 , Tak Weaver was working as a guide for caravans along the route of Monster Alley. His trips allowed him to be quite knowledgeable about The Wilds, Suthoran, and the Northern Hills.
On the 3rd day of the Red Moon of 436, Tak died while facing a strange tentacle-eyed monster that was a trap set by Mikarish, the first queen of the Ogres. He died while protecting Tinky Da Brave from the Spirit's attacks. When he died, Sirnai offered to allow him to come back, but it would end his journey with him and he would be in service of another. Tak declined and released his soul to the realm of Sirnai in the Eternal Domain.
